Chicken Alfredo Florentine

  • 1 lb. (450 g) bo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 Tbsp. (15 mL) olive oil
  • 1 can (398 mL) no-salt-added diced tomatoes with basil and oregano, drained
  • 1 cup (250 mL) water
  • 1/2 cup (125 mL) lowfat milk
  • 1 pouch Knorr® Sidekicks® Fettuccine Alfredo Pasta Side Dish
  • 2 cups (500 mL) baby spinach leaves
  • 2 Tbsp. (30 mL) grated Parmesan cheese

Chicken Alfredo Florentine
  1. Cut chicken into bite-sized pieces. Heat oil in large nonstick skillet over high heat and cook chicken until browned, about 1-1/2 minutes.

  2. Add diced tomatoes, water, milk and Knorr® Sidekicks® Fettuccine Alfredo Pasta Side Dish. Cover and boil 6 minutes.

  3. Stir in spinach; continue cooking 2 more minutes. Sprinkle with grated Parmesan.

Tip: For a meatless version, use extra-firm tofu chunks instead of chicken. Simply brown the chunks as in step 1, then remove. Stir back into skillet along with spinach to reheat.
